With Google Sheets, you can create and edit spreadsheets directly in your web browser—no special software is required. Multiple people can work simultaneously, you can see people’s changes as they make them, and every change is saved automatically. When using numbers as part of your query, a space or a dash (-) will separate a number while a dot (.) will be a decimal. For example, 01.2047-100 is considered 2 numbers: 01.2047 and 100. When you use negative search operators, conversations with excluded criteria may still appear. This occurs because Gmail identifies matching messages first. Welcome to Shifts, the employee scheduling and time tracking app included with Microsoft Teams. With Shifts and Teams, you and your team have one place for your scheduling, communication, and collaboration needs to get work done, from anywhere, on any device. You can create, edit, and manage a schedule with Shifts in Microsoft Teams. A shift schedule displays days at the top, team members appear on the left, and the assigned shifts appear in the...

Software is a set of instructions, data, or programs that tell a computer how to operate. It is the intangible counterpart to hardware—the physical components of a computer system. Learn what software is and explore all types of computer software with examples. Comprehensive guide covering system, application, and modern software categories. Software can be broadly categorized into three main types: System Software: This type of software manages the fundamental operations of a computer or device. Examples include operating systems (e.g., Windows, macOS, Linux) and device drivers that control hardware components.
